Uzbekistan: Oat Market 2025

Oat Market Size in Uzbekistan

The Uzbek oat market stood at less than $X in 2022, leveling off at the previous year. Over the period under review, consumption showed a relatively flat trend pattern.

Oat Production in Uzbekistan

In value terms, oat production rose to $X in 2022 estimated in export price. Overall, production, however, saw a remarkable increase.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2019 with an increase of 41%. Over the period under review, production reached the maximum level at $X in 2020; however, from 2021 to 2022, production stood at a somewhat lower figure.

The average yield of oats in Uzbekistan dropped to X tons per ha in 2022, standing approx. at the year before. In general, the yield recorded a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 when the yield increased by 0.2%. The oat yield peaked at X tons per ha in 2019; afterwards, it flattened through to 2022. Despite the increased use of modern agricultural techniques and methods, future yield figures may still be impacted by adverse weather conditions.

The oat harvested area in Uzbekistan dropped rapidly to X ha in 2022, which is down by -48.2% on the previous year's figure. Over the period under review, the harvested area, however, continues to indicate a significant incre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 with an increase of 2,721% against the previous year. As a result, the harvested area reached the peak level of X ha, and then fell sharply in the following year.

Oat Imports

Imports into Uzbekistan

In 2022, after three years of decline, there was significant growth in purchases abroad of oats, when their volume increased by 17% to X tons. In general, imports enjoyed significant growth.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2018 when imports increased by 481%. As a result, imports attained the peak of X tons. From 2019 to 2022, the growth of imports failed to regain momentum.

In value terms, oat imports reached $X in 2022. Overall, imports continue to indicate a significant expansion.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2018 with an increase of 417% against the previous year. Imports peaked at $X in 2019; however, from 2020 to 2022, imports stood at a somewhat lower figure.

Imports by Country

In 2022, Kazakhstan (X tons) was the main oat supplier to Uzbekistan, accounting for a approx. 99.9% share of total imports.

From 2017 to 2022, the average annual growth rate of volume from Kazakhstan totaled +20.5%.

In value terms, Kazakhstan ($X) constituted the largest supplier of oats to Uzbekistan.

From 2017 to 2022, the average annual rate of growth in terms of value from Kazakhstan amounted to +30.7%.

Import Prices by Country

In 2022, the average oat import price amounted to $X per ton, with a decrease of -3.8% against the previous year. Over the period under review, import price indicated a strong increase from 2017 to 2022: its price increased at an average annual rate of +7.8% over the last five years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2022 figures, oat import price increased by +63.5% against 2018 indices.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when the average import price increased by 27%. As a result, import price attained the peak level of $X per ton, and then shrank in the following year.

As there is only one major supplying country, the average price level is determined by prices for Kazakhstan.

From 2017 to 2022, the rate of growth in terms of prices for Kazakhstan amounted to +8.3% per year.

The countries with the highest volumes of oat consumption in 2021 were Russia, Canada and the United States, together comprising 37% of global consumption.
The countries with the highest volumes of oat production in 2021 were Canada, Russia and Poland, with a combined 42% share of global production. These countries were followed by Finland, Australia, Spain, the UK, Brazil, the United States, Sweden, Germany, Argentina and China, which together accounted for a further 36%.
In value terms, Kazakhstan constituted the largest supplier of oat to Uzbekistan, comprising 81% of total imports. The second position in the ranking was occupied by Russia, with a 16% share of total imports.
In 2021, the average oat import price amounted to $116 per ton, remaining stable against the previous year.
